Microsoft .NET Core 7 and ASP.NET Core 7 reached end-of-life on 14 May 2024 (https://dotnet.microsoft.com/en-us/download/dotnet/7.0); the lack of support implies that Microsoft will no longer release new security patches for the product, which may result in security vulnerabilities.
What is the plan to update CSET to use a supported .NET runtime and ASP.NET?
